Evidence-based security policy Based on code as well as user Metadata Extensible application information Increase capabilities Common Language Runtime Powerful code execution environment Common type system Garbage-collection Security .NET Framework Library > 6,000 classes and Interfaces Accessible from any .NET language Proposed Equipment File Server Hardware: (1)Gateway 920 Software: (1) Windows Server 2003 Mail Server Hardware: (1)Gateway 920 Software: (1) Windows Server 2003 Web Server Hardware: (2)Gateway 920 Software: (2) Windows Server 2003 Networking Equipment Cisco Routers (3) 2611XM (2) NM16ESW ( 15 )1200 Access Point (1) 4000 WLAN Switch (1) Air Control System software (5) Systems Wireless Print Server (1) Systems Wireless Print Server (48) Systems Wireless PCMCIA LAN Adapter (54) Systems Wireless PC LAN Adapter Card (2) 16 port 10/100 Base-T Ethernet Module for 2611XM Router (3) Serial WAN Interface Card WIC-1T (1) VPN Encryption Module AIM-VPN/EP (6) Air Powerline Injector Other hardware (4) Intel 4 Processor (4) PC2100 DDR ECC SDRAM (2 - 256MB modules) (4) 80 GB Hard Drive (4) Tape Backup Unit (1) Systems Wireless Print Server (4) Floppy Drive (4) LCD Monitor Input Devices (4) Mice (4) Keyboard (4) Modem (4) Network Card (4) APC Battery Supply (4) Database Server Software (1) FrontPage 2003 HTML Editor Proposal The past decades have massively transformed the way people work and live with the advent use of the internet and the widespread introduction of personal mobile communications. During the next decade, these two digital industries are expected to converge, requiring wireless networks to facilitate user mobility by providing the desired information anywhere at any time. Example applications in this context comprise access to email, intranet and internet, the distribution of multimedia content in home and hot spot environments, replacement of Ethernet networks in offices, and wireless peripheral interfaces for digital equipment. Naturally, users of wireless networks expect the same high quality of service and ease of use as known from wire based solutions. This translates into a multitude of challenges: high capacity reserves, in order to support the extreme peak data rates, reconfigurability and multi-band operation in order to provide service in a heterogeneous environment, and plug-and-play network configuration in order to enable fast and flexible set-ups. Currently deployed cellular and ad-hoc wireless networks (2G, 3G, and WLAN) are not able to cope with these requirements, simply because they do not support the required data rates and/or lack interoperability with other standards. Design Justification The current network design is not compatible with the new technology or design requirements. In lieu of this a new cabling system and equipments are needed to bring the university up to date and would meet the requirements set forth. Looking at the design diagram, the proposal is specifying or requiring the use of either parabolic antenna’s or microwave antenna’s to minimize cost and maintenance. Having this technology can also give students and employee’s access to the network wherever they are in the campus. This way the only cabling that we would be doing are for the laboratories and administration offices. The rest like the school housing and classrooms would be connecting to the network using wireless connections. The wireless network that would be setup would be high speed wireless network connection and can handle both data and multimedia. Access to the wireless network is secured and only those that have applied for access or filled up an online application form would be given access to the wireless network. Business process and policies would be in place to safeguard unauthorized connections and attacks. Security keys would change randomly in a specified timeline and registered students and employee’s would be given instructions in how to change the password or they can proceed to the I.T. department for technical assistance. The hardware component that would be in place has security capabilities and the design would also include equipments that can monitor the health and unauthorized access. The security measures would also block websites that were identified as obscene or violent in nature.
